The Military Mounted Police first engaged in combat in 1882 at the Battle of Tel el-Kebir. Although technically two independent corps, these two effectively functioned as a single organisation. In 1926 they were fully amalgamated to form the Corps of Military Police (CMP). In recognition of their service in the Second World War, they became the ...
Italian military troops adopted the grey-green uniform prior to WWI in 1908. It was Luigi Brioschi, president of the Milanese section of the C.A.I. (Italian Alpine Club) in 1905 who presented a combat uniform more suitable for modern war, replacing the showy uniforms of the Royal Sardinian Army.Brioschi demonstrated the benefits of his grey green uniform on painted …
The military luxury of maintaining the variety of uniforms could only be supported under peacetime conditions. The outbreak of war forced the German army to simplify it's field uniform. This occurred twice in 1915, and again in 1917. This is a photo of a young Prussian N.C.O. circa 1912 in his dress uniform.

World War II German Army ranks and insignia. The German Army of the Nazi era inherited its uniforms and rank structure from the Reichsheer of the Weimar republic (1921–1935), many of whose traditions went back to the Imperial Army of the German Empire and earlier. The Reichsheer was renamed Weacht Heer in May 1935.
Royal Navy Petty Officer and Rating Insignia of World War I. The structure of the Royal Navy's enlisted personnel in the World War I period is complex and can be hard to summarize. From the relatively simple organization of the sailing navy, new technologies and specialties had been incorporated in various branches which evolved at their own pace with little overall coordination ...

The First World War (1914-18) The total Military Police strength at the outbreak of war was 508 all ranks - immediately increased to 761 with the recall of all reservists, many of whom had been civil policemen. By 1918, Corps strength was over 25,000 all ranks and battalions of famous regiments such as the Honourable Artillery Company, the Oxfordshire and Buckinghamshire …
During World War II the first flight nurses uniform consisted of a blue wool battle dress jacket, blue wool trousers and a blue wool men's style maroon piped garrison cap. The uniform was worn with either the ANC light blue or white shirt and black tie. After 1943 the ANC adopted olive drab service uniforms similar to the newly formed WAC ...

The photograph below depicts the Hospital Blues Uniform that was worn by patients in Military or Convalescence Hospitals during World War One. A History of this convalescence suit follows. The Hospital Blues uniform was worn by those patients who could get out of bed. They were a flannel type material of Oxford blue hue with a single breasted suit and trousers. Each had a …

Jack Fawcett served with the 8th Hussars and 3rd Hussars in the 1920's. He re-enlisted in the Corps of Military Police in December 1939 and served in France in 1940 and North Africa and the Middle East from 1942 onwards.
